Transaction 6e5d31a5dc232da1309184fd7d7b367883f330f2aa1819ba3b371936bf63d034
1 Input
1 Output
-
6e5d31a5dc232da1309184fd7d7b367883f330f2aa1819ba3b371936bf63d034:0
- value
- 72073981
- script pubkey
- OP_0 OP_PUSHBYTES_20 2903a9f53cf8af4b33937a54130b3966f09574b0
- address
- bc1q9yp6nafulzh5kvun0f2pxzeevmcf2a9sg8pyny